Design and construction week Las Vegas

Gotcha Covered • Sep 21, 2021

What happens in Vegas stays in Vegas?! Not in this case, we are way too excited to share! Our owners and some of the designers had the great opportunity to attend the Design and Construction week in Las Vegas in January and saw a lot of great new things coming to the market! Companies like Omega Cabinetry, Organized Living, Wilsonart, Formica, and many others all came together to show their latest and greatest. Eight to ten mile walks a day later, here are a few items that we noted are going to be BIG this year.

Tile

Continued rise of Subway tile as well as beveled subway tile. Tile flooring that looks like wood is also a continued favorite this year.

Flooring

Luxury vinyl Tile (LVT) and brick is for flooring is all the rage this year!

Kitchen/Bars

Flat islands, patterned back splashes (including the 3x6 subway tile craze), and using every bit of space to stay organized. Bringing in Nature in small doses. Islands specifically are taking center stage (get it?) in kitchens by getting larger and more ornate with intricate leg designs, corbels, organizing built ins and accent coloring.

Colors

2016 appears to be continuing the modern obsession with Neutral colors like whites and gray with pops of colors and textures like the champagne gold accents like cabinet hardware.

Hardware

Last but not least is the accentuation of hardware this year, while it's always been a great way to spice up a living space, it appears to be front and center this year.
